The Psychology of Online Betting and Slot Gameplay

1. The Gambler’s Fallacy: One of the most pervasive cognitive biases in gambling is the gambler’s fallacy. This is the belief that past outcomes can influence future events, leading players to make irrational decisions based on perceived patterns or trends. For example, a player might think that a slot machine is “due” for a big win because it has been paying out less frequently, even though each https://jokacasinoau.com.co/top-games/ spin is independent and random.

2. Loss Aversion: Another key concept in the psychology of gambling is loss aversion. This is the tendency for players to prefer avoiding losses over acquiring gains, even when the potential gains outweigh the losses. In online betting, this can manifest as players chasing their losses and continuing to wager in the hopes of recouping their losses, even if it means risking more money.

3. Reward Systems: Online casinos and gambling platforms are designed to provide players with constant rewards and reinforcement through various mechanisms, such as bonuses, free spins, and loyalty programs. These rewards trigger the brain’s dopamine system, creating a sense of excitement and pleasure that motivates players to keep playing. Over time, this can lead to a cycle of reward-seeking behavior and addiction.

4. Social Proof: Humans are social creatures who are influenced by the behaviors and opinions of others. In online betting and slot gameplay, players may be swayed by the actions of fellow gamblers or the perceived success of others. This can lead to herd mentality, where players follow the crowd and make decisions based on what they believe to be popular or successful strategies.

5. Illusion of Control: Many gamblers fall victim to the illusion of control, believing that they have a greater degree of influence over the outcome of their bets or spins than they actually do. This can lead to overconfidence and risky decision-making, as players mistakenly believe that they can outsmart the system or predict the results with greater accuracy.
